Team, Thursday's disaster-recovery drill exercised Brindlequeue's compaction path under simulated broker loss. Compaction resumed cleanly on two of three partitions; the third stalled because the compaction checkpoint store came up sealed, exactly the failure mode we wanted to rehearse. Manual unseal took eleven minutes, mostly spent locating credentials — that is the gap to close before the next drill. Full timeline is in the drill doc. For future drills, the checkpoint store unseal accepts the recovery passphrase recorded below.

strongbox words: wenix-ulador

## Local Setup

The Gristmill CLI performs batch image resizing for release asset pipelines. After installing the toolchain, run the init command to generate a default profile covering output dimensions, format conversions, and concurrency limits. Job history and dedupe checksums are persisted to a local job-tracking database so reruns skip completed assets. Before cutting a release build, configure the job database using the connection string that follows.

primary connection of tajeg-tajop = postgresql://julax_svc:DI@db-e7f3.kelvidyn.corp:5432/rusdor

Subject: On-call handover — Flagwright rollout framework

Handing over Flagwright on-call. Current state: the v3 rollout API is stable, but the plugin validation hook is rejecting some third-party manifests built against the old schema. Plugin authors affected by this should regenerate manifests with the v3 CLI; the migration guide covers it. No open incidents otherwise. If external plugin authors report rejections they cannot resolve after migration, direct them to the framework support inbox.

billing contact of hahig-yajop = fraael_fraox@nelvrocorp.internal

Hey Marisol — handing off the ReportForge sort work before I'm out. Short version: the builder's multi-column sort was unstable because we swapped to a parallel sort in 4.2, so rows with equal keys shuffled between runs. I pinned it back to the stable merge path and added a regression fixture. Perf hit is ~3%, acceptable per Devi. Flag it in the release notes so QA stops filing dupes. The current service configuration is as follows:

service settings:
PRAIX_LOG_LEVEL=error
PRAIX_METRICS_HOST=metrics.praix.qorvelcorp.corp
PRAIX_POOL_SIZE=16